Highest Education Level

Secretarys in New Mexico off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
32.0%
High School or GED
25.3%
Associate's Degree
17.5%
Vocational Degree or Certification
13.3%
Master's Degree
8.1%
Some College
2.2%
Doctorate Degree
0.9%
Some High School
0.8%
